Output 67625dc018cefd7b76def14e9851de069be057e360e082d95cdfac60244d0900:30

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23a1ebfde17ef9d556cec47741214257c1c12aea88c9701a6a9c97de3bc7b13d
address
bc1pyws7hl0p0mua24kwc3m5zg2z2lquz2h23ryhqxn2njtauw78ky7sye342l
transaction
67625dc018cefd7b76def14e9851de069be057e360e082d95cdfac60244d0900
spent
true